EPA under Pruitt slashed $350 million in regulations, 300,000 hours of red tape.....
washingtonexaminer ^ | 7/23/2018 | PaulBedford

Posted on 07/23/2018 9:09:42 PM PDT by caww

A new report on the agency’s efforts found that the EPA “was a net deregulatory agency,” and a highlight of President Trump’s effort to eliminate many Obama-era regulations.

What’s more, the American Action Forum report found that Pruitt set in place an anti-regulatory mindset that should keep the EPA at the leading edge of deregulation under Trump.

In the report, provided to Secrets, Goldbeck cited these highlights:

Final rules from the agency produced nearly $350 million in cost savings and cut more than 300,000 hours of paperwork burdens. In addition to specific rulemaking actions, Pruitt established the framework for a substantial shift in EPA’s mission and practices. The most notable changes included: narrowing the agency’s regulatory scope, reforming the practice of “sue and settle,” and re-examining the data and analytical processes used to justify rulemakings. While EPA’s leadership will change, the Pruitt-era policy changes will almost certainly continue. The agency is on track to exceed its deregulatory target for this year, and it is only a matter of time before its most high-profile deregulatory measures (e.g. Clean Power Plan Repeal and adjusted fuel efficiency standards) wind their way through the rulemaking process. “The fact that EPA was a net cost-cutter during his tenure is significant,” said the report.

Goldbeck lists specific changes that led to the savings, but also emphasized the impact of Pruitt’s war on how the agency’s pro-regulation culture has changed.

24 Jul: Bloomberg: Trump to Seek Repeal of California’s Smog-Fighting Power
By Ryan Beene, Jennifer A Dlouhy, John Lippert, and Ari Natter
The Trump administration will seek to revoke California’s authority to regulate automobile greenhouse gas emissions — including its mandate for electric-car sales — in a proposed revision of Obama-era standards, according to three people familiar with the plan.

The proposal, expected to be released this week, amounts to a frontal assault on one of former President Barack Obama’s signature regulatory programs to curb emissions that contribute to climate change. It also sets up a high-stakes battle over California’s unique ability to combat air pollution and, if finalized, is sure to set off a protracted courtroom battle...
If Trump’s plan sticks, it could be his biggest regulatory rollback yet...

“Congress didn’t intend for California to set national fuel economy standards,” said Steve Milloy, a policy adviser for the Heartland Institute, a group critical of climate science. “It’s nutty it’s been allowed to develop. National fuel economy standards are set by the federal government so that’s what we are going to do.”
